1. A method for the control of an assembly by a control unit, in particular in a motor vehicle, wherein the assembly includes at least one component, at least one actuator associated with the component and an additional control unit having a first non-volatile memory section which is connected to the control unit, with the control unit including a second non-volatile memory section, comprising:

  • reading out and transmitting classification information associated with the assembly and stored in the first non-volatile memory section to the control unit, the control unit being distinct and spatially separated from the assembly;

    storing the transmitted classification information in the second non-volatile memory section of the control unit; and

    reading out and transmitting the classification information stored in the second non-volatile memory section to the additional control unit, wherein the classification information transmitted to the additional control unit is stored in the first non-volatile memory section if the first non-volatile memory section does not contain any classification information and the classification information transmitted to the additional control unit is not stored in the first non-volatile memory section if the first non-volatile memory section already contains classification information.
